virtualbox 5.1 (rc=-1912)

bzzi

Местный житель
Регистрация
5 Мар 2016
Сообщения
160
Реакции
20
Всем привет! Ставлю virtualbox с оф сайта, но при запуске такие ошибки:

RTR3InitEx failed with rc=-1912 (rc=-1912)

The VirtualBox kernel modules do not match this version of VirtualBox. The installation of VirtualBox was apparently not successful. Executing

'/sbin/vboxconfig'

may correct this. Make sure that you do not mix the OSE version and the PUEL version of VirtualBox.

where: supR3HardenedMainInitRuntime what: 4 VERR_VM_DRIVER_VERSION_MISMATCH (-1912) - The installed support driver doesn't match the version of the user.

и

The virtual machine 'win' has terminated unexpectedly during startup with exit code 1 (0x1).


Код ошибки:

NS_ERROR_FAILURE (0x80004005)

Компонент:

MachineWrap

Интерфейс:

IMachine {b2547866-a0a1-4391-8b86-6952d82efaa0}

Помогите пожалуйста
 

starwanderer

Хранитель порядка
Команда форума
Модератор
Регистрация
20 Ноя 2016
Сообщения
1.594
Реакции
3.334
Вы, видимо, пытались установить VB другим способом, к примеру, из репозитария OS, с которой работаете.
У вас остались в системе файлы ядра VB, которые конфликтуют с устанавливаемой версией.
Вы смешали файлы Open source редакции (OSE) и VirtualBox Personal Use and Evaluation License (PUEL).
Выход: удалить подчистую все пакеты VB и поставить либо целиком из репозитария OS, либо с сайта VB.
 

bzzi

Местный житель
Регистрация
5 Мар 2016
Сообщения
160
Реакции
20
Вы, видимо, пытались установить VB другим способом, к примеру, из репозитария OS, с которой...
Выход: удалить подчистую все пакеты VB и поставить либо целиком из репозитария OS, либо с сайта VB.

А не подскажите как это сделать?
 

starwanderer

Хранитель порядка
Команда форума
Модератор
Регистрация
20 Ноя 2016
Сообщения
1.594
Реакции
3.334
Какой дистрибутив Linux и версия?
Вам нужна OSE или PUEL ? (Если запускать Windows с гостевыми дополнениями, то PUEL).
 
  • Нравится
Реакции: bzzi

bzzi

Местный житель
Регистрация
5 Мар 2016
Сообщения
160
Реакции
20
Я уже сломал всю систему и поставил заново, всё установилось (PUEL), спасибо!

Но выявил баг:
Создаю разметку на втором жестком, всё ставится без проблем, но после перезагрузки всего компа пишет об отсутствии файла vdi
VD: error VERR_FILE_NOT_FOUND opening image file '/media/.../win.vdi' (VERR_FILE_NOT_FOUND).
Диск примонтирован, открывается
 
Последнее редактирование:

starwanderer

Хранитель порядка
Команда форума
Модератор
Регистрация
20 Ноя 2016
Сообщения
1.594
Реакции
3.334
Но выявил баг:
Создаю разметку на втором жестком, всё ставится без проблем, но после перезагрузки всего компа пишет об отсутствии файла vdi
VD: error VERR_FILE_NOT_FOUND opening image file '/media/.../win.vdi' (VERR_FILE_NOT_FOUND).
Диск примонтирован, открывается
Возможно, нужно дать права на файл и каталог группе vboxusers.

А всё-таки, под каким дистрибутивом ставили ? Видимо, под Centos ?

Сам, в основном, работаю под Debian и его производными, и особых проблем с установкой VBox не было.
Вчера поднял Centos 7, и там есть тонкие моменты с VBox.
- Должны подгружаться библиотеки, совпадающие с версией ядра, что не всегда происходит и это нужно контроллировать и иногда принудительно подгружать нужную версию.
- Должна быть последняя версия EPEL.
- В части HowTo указывают устаревшие команды для пересбоки ядра VBox, соответственно пресборка не происходит и ничего не работает.

Оставлю Для просмотра ссылки Войди или Зарегистрируйся
Может кому-то пригодится.
 
Последнее редактирование:
Сверху